Horrifying video shows a racing car barrel-rolling several times into a crowd of terrified fans at a race in Argentina, killing a 25-year-old spectator.
A Volkswagen Polo R5 clipped a dirt mound during Sunday’s event in Mina Clavero, sending it flying toward fans standing on rocks watching the race.
A woman was seen desperately pulling a small girl in a blue top out of the way of the car, which hurtled by, shedding debris in the crash.
The car rolled a total of six times before coming to a stop, Motorsport reported.
Spectator Brahian Zarate Gonzalez, 25, died of his injuries at a hospital, while a woman, 40, was left with a broken ankle and a young girl suffered bruising. One image showed the woman screaming in pain while being treated at the scene.
Driver Didier Arias and co-driver Hector Nunez avoided serious injury following the accident during the second round of the Rally Sudamericano Mina Clavero event.
International Automobile Federation bosses expressed their “deepest sympathies and sincere condolences” to the victims.
